R
You can download the latest version of R using one of the following
links (depending on which operating system you use):
- Windows: Install R by downloading and running this
.exe
file from CRAN.
- macOS: Install R by downloading and running this .pkg file
from CRAN.
- Linux: You can download the binary files for your
distribution from CRAN.
Alternatively, you can use your package manager (e.g., for
Debian/Ubuntu, run
sudo apt-get install r-base; for Fedora,
run sudo yum install R).
RStudio
You will also need to install RStudio, which is the programming
environment we will use to access R. You can download the latest version
of RStudio here. Use the
download link that is appropriate for your operating system.
After you have downloaded RStudio, update the default
settings. In RStudio’s Global Options:
- Uncheck Restore .RData into workspace at startup
- Set Save workspaces to .RData on exit to
NEVER
